Free tax help is available at the following locations:


  • Bentworth Senior Center, W - 10 a.m. – 3 p.m. 2/14 – 4/4. Call 724-239-5887.
  • Washington Senior Center, M, T, H - 8 a.m. – 12 p.m. 2/5 – 4/13. Call 724-222-8566.
  • Presbyterian Senior Center, F - 10 a.m. – 2 p.m. 2/9 – 4/6. Call 724-250-4993.
  • Burgettstown Senior Center, T, H - 10 a.m. – 3 p.m. 2/13 – 4/5. Call 724-947-9524.
  • Midway Firehouse, By appointment only. 2/26 and 3/12. Call 724-467-0607.
  • McDonald/Cecil Senior Center, H - 9:30 a.m. – 1:30 p.m. 2/8 – 4/12. Call 724-743-1827.
  • Peters Twp. Public Library, T, W, H - Call for hours. Call 724-941-9430.

Taxpayers MUST make an appointment and bring last year's tax return, all 2017 tax documents, and photo IDs. Taxpayers eligible for the PA property tax and rent rebate must bring original stamped 2017 property tax receipts or a signed form PA 1000 RC from their landlord showing the amount of rent paid for 2017. If you must cancel your appointment, please call as early as possible so that we may help another taxpayer.

Volunteers are trained and IRS-certified and can prepare federal, state, and local income tax returns as well as PA property tax and rent rebate requests. Completed returns are filed electronically with both the IRS and the PA Department of Revenue unless paper returns are required. There are limitations as to the types of returns that can be prepared and returns including rentals, farm income, depreciation, and businesses with employees will be referred to a paid preparer. Taxpayers with complex returns or large gas well royalties may also be referred to a paid preparer.

                                                                                                             

For further information and questions, contact Dean Rath, the Washington County District Coordinator, at 724-941-7608.
